The metric system measures land area using the square meter (m²) or hectare (ha) unit. To convert between the two, you can use the following formula: 1 hectare = 10,000 square meters. This system allows for precise calculations and comparisons of land areas, making it an ideal choice for real estate development, urban planning, and agriculture.
